A LORRY driver who was found dead in a lay-by on the Aire Valley trunk road near Steeton has been named by coroner's officers as Polish national Krzysztos Bogdan Sron.
Mr Sron, 63, who lived in Sheffield, was discovered on the ground near the articulated lorry he had been driving by a passing motorist on Monday morning.
He was pronounced dead at the scene.
The lorry operator, Doncaster-based Emms and Son Limited, has declined to comment.
Mr Sron died of natural causes so there will not be an inquest, said a spokesman at Bradford Coroner's Office.
